Wireless Application Protocol (WAP) คืออะไร?
เผยแพร่แล้ว: 2021-11-03โทรศัพท์มือถือรุ่นก่อน ๆ สามารถเข้าถึงอินเทอร์เน็ตได้โดยใช้ Wireless Application Protocol (WAP) ซึ่งเป็นมาตรฐานเก่า WAP Gateway ระบุอุปกรณ์ที่เชื่อมต่อกับอินเทอร์เน็ตและจัดรูปแบบเนื้อหาที่ส่งไปยังอุปกรณ์ตามขนาดและประเภทหน้าจอ
ซอฟต์แวร์มีความยุ่งยาก มักจะล้มเหลวในการแสดงหน้าจออย่างถูกต้อง และไม่ได้ใช้งานอีกต่อไป
บริษัทสี่แห่งสร้างมาตรฐานนี้ ได้แก่ Motorola, Ericsson, Nokia และ Unwired Planet โทรศัพท์มือถือรุ่นใหม่กว่าสามารถเข้าถึงอินเทอร์เน็ตได้ในลักษณะเดียวกับคอมพิวเตอร์เดสก์ท็อปและแล็ปท็อป ดังนั้นโปรโตคอลนี้จึงไม่จำเป็นอีกต่อไป
- นิยามโปรโตคอลแอปพลิเคชันไร้สาย
- WAP ทำงานอย่างไร
- ทำไมต้องใช้ WAP?
- ข้อดีและข้อเสียของ WAP
- กองโปรโตคอล WAP
- อนาคตของ WAP
Wireless Application Protocol (WAP) คืออะไร?
Wireless Application Protocol (WAP) เป็นโปรโตคอลการสลับแพ็กเก็ตที่ใช้ในการเข้าถึงข้อมูลไร้สายผ่านเครือข่ายไร้สายมือถือส่วนใหญ่ นอกเหนือจากการอำนวยความสะดวกในการสื่อสารแบบทันทีระหว่างอุปกรณ์ไร้สายแบบโต้ตอบและอินเทอร์เน็ต WAP ยังปรับปรุงความสามารถในการทำงานร่วมกันของข้อกำหนดไร้สาย
WAP ทำงานภายในสภาพแวดล้อมแบบเปิด และสามารถสร้างได้บนระบบปฏิบัติการประเภทใดก็ได้ เป็นวิธีที่นิยมในการส่งข้อมูลไปยังผู้ใช้มือถือ
ด้วย WAP cascading style sheet (CSS) นักพัฒนาสามารถจัดรูปแบบขนาดหน้าจอเพื่อให้ทำงานบนอุปกรณ์เคลื่อนที่ได้ การใช้ WAP CSS ช่วยให้มั่นใจได้ถึงความเข้ากันได้กับหน้าจอแสดงผลของอุปกรณ์เคลื่อนที่ต่างๆ ดังนั้นจึงไม่จำเป็นต้องจัดรูปแบบใหม่
โปรโตคอลดาตาแกรม WAP เป็นอินเทอร์เฟซหลักของสถาปัตยกรรม WAP ซึ่งจัดการโปรโตคอลเลเยอร์การถ่ายโอนของโมเดลอินเทอร์เน็ตและอำนวยความสะดวกในการสื่อสารระหว่างเครือข่ายไร้สายเคลื่อนที่และแพลตฟอร์มที่ไม่ขึ้นกับโปรโตคอลชั้นบน
การดำเนินงานทั่วโลกแบบไร้สายสามารถเข้าถึงเกตเวย์ไร้สายได้อย่างง่ายดายผ่านชั้นการขนส่ง ซึ่งเกี่ยวข้องกับปัญหาเครือข่ายทางกายภาพ เกตเวย์ WAP คือเซิร์ฟเวอร์ที่อนุญาตให้เข้าถึงเครือข่ายไร้สาย
นอกเหนือจากการทดสอบเครื่องมือ WAP และข้อกำหนดการพัฒนาแล้ว Open Mobile Alliance (OMA) ยังให้การสนับสนุนสำหรับบริการมือถือทั้งหมด
WAP ทำงานอย่างไร
ชุดโปรโตคอล WAP อธิบายชุดของโปรโตคอล มาตรฐานนี้อนุญาตให้มีการทำงานร่วมกันระหว่างอุปกรณ์ WAP เช่น โทรศัพท์มือถือที่ใช้โปรโตคอล และซอฟต์แวร์ WAP เช่น เว็บเบราว์เซอร์และเทคโนโลยีเครือข่าย
มาตรฐานดังกล่าวปรับปรุงประสบการณ์การใช้งานอุปกรณ์พกพาซึ่งก่อนหน้านี้ถูกจำกัดโดยเครือข่ายไร้สายและอุปกรณ์พกพา
WAP ทำได้โดย:
- หน้าสามารถส่งผ่าน WAP ในรูปแบบ WML
- มาตรฐาน เช่น XML, UDP และ IP นั้นมีประสิทธิภาพสำหรับสภาพแวดล้อมไร้สาย แต่ไม่มีข้อมูลจำนวนมาก เช่น HTML, HTTP และ TLS
- ช่วยให้บีบอัดข้อมูลได้มากขึ้นโดยใช้การส่งข้อมูลแบบไบนารี
- ด้วยการใช้สแต็กโปรโตคอลที่มีน้ำหนักเบา เวลาแฝงสูง ความเสถียรในการเชื่อมต่อต่ำ และแบนด์วิดท์ต่ำสามารถทำได้
WAP Model และ Layers
ในรูปแบบ WAP ไคลเอ็นต์และเซิร์ฟเวอร์จะสื่อสารกับเกตเวย์ WAP เพิ่มเติมซึ่งทำหน้าที่เป็นตัวกลางระหว่างกัน เกตเวย์จะแปลงคำขออุปกรณ์ WAP ที่ส่งโดยไมโครเบราว์เซอร์เป็นคำขอ HTTP URL ที่ส่งผ่านอินเทอร์เน็ต
เกตเวย์ WAP รับการตอบสนองจากเซิร์ฟเวอร์และแปลงเป็นไฟล์ WML ที่ไมโครเบราว์เซอร์บนอุปกรณ์มือถือสามารถอ่านได้
ทำไมต้องใช้ WAP?
ในปี พ.ศ. 2542 WAP ได้ถูกนำมาใช้เพื่อให้ผู้ให้บริการเครือข่ายไร้สาย ผู้ให้บริการเนื้อหา และผู้ใช้ปลายทางได้รับประโยชน์จาก:
ผู้ประกอบการเครือข่ายไร้สายและโทรศัพท์มือถือ
ด้วย WAP จะสามารถปรับปรุงบริการข้อมูลไร้สาย เช่น ข้อความเสียง ในขณะที่สามารถพัฒนาแอปพลิเคชันมือถือใหม่ได้ ไม่จำเป็นต้องแก้ไขโทรศัพท์หรือเปลี่ยนแปลงโครงสร้างพื้นฐานเพิ่มเติม
ผู้ให้บริการเนื้อหา
WAP ทำให้นักพัฒนาแอปพลิเคชันบุคคลที่สามสามารถใช้ประโยชน์จากแอปพลิเคชันและฟังก์ชันโทรศัพท์มือถือเพิ่มเติมได้ นักพัฒนาสามารถสร้างแอปพลิเคชันมือถือที่มีประสิทธิภาพโดยการเขียนแอปพลิเคชันใน WML
ผู้ใช้ปลายทาง
กล่าวกันว่าผู้ที่มีโทรศัพท์มือถือจะได้รับประโยชน์จากการเข้าถึงบริการออนไลน์ที่ง่ายดายและปลอดภัย เช่น การธนาคาร ความบันเทิง การส่งข้อความ และข้อมูลอื่นๆ การเข้าถึงฐานข้อมูลองค์กรและแอปพลิเคชันทางธุรกิจผ่าน WAP นั้นมีไว้สำหรับข้อมูลอินทราเน็ตเช่นกัน
แม้จะมีประโยชน์เหล่านี้ WAP ก็ไม่ได้รับการยอมรับอย่างกว้างขวางในหลายประเทศ และการใช้งานก็ลดลงอย่างเห็นได้ชัดในช่วงปี 2010 เนื่องจากโทรศัพท์มือถือรองรับ HTML มากขึ้น
ประโยชน์ของ WAP
ต่อไปนี้เป็นข้อดีบางประการของ Wireless Application Protocol หรือ WAP:
- WAP เป็นเทคโนโลยีที่เคลื่อนไหวเร็วมาก
- เทคโนโลยีนี้เป็นโอเพ่นซอร์สและฟรีทั้งหมด
- สามารถใช้หลายแพลตฟอร์มเพื่อนำไปใช้ได้
- มาตรฐานเครือข่ายไม่เกี่ยวข้อง
- มีตัวเลือกการควบคุมที่สูงขึ้น
- จำลองตามอินเทอร์เน็ต มีการใช้งานในลักษณะเดียวกัน
- สามารถส่ง/รับข้อมูลแบบเรียลไทม์โดยใช้ WAP
- WAP ได้รับการสนับสนุนโดยโทรศัพท์มือถือและอุปกรณ์ที่ทันสมัยส่วนใหญ่
ข้อเสียของ WAP
นี่คือข้อเสียบางประการของ Wireless Application Protocol:
- ใน WAP ความเร็วในการเชื่อมต่อจะช้าและความพร้อมใช้งานมีจำกัด
- การเข้าถึงอินเทอร์เน็ตมีน้อยมากในบางพื้นที่ และในบางพื้นที่ก็ใช้งานไม่ได้โดยสิ้นเชิง
- ระบบมีความปลอดภัยน้อย
- ส่วนต่อประสานผู้ใช้ (UI) มีขนาดเล็กใน WAP
กองโปรโตคอล WAP
โดยเฉพาะอย่างยิ่ง จะอธิบายเลเยอร์ต่างๆ ของการสื่อสารและการส่งข้อมูลที่เกี่ยวข้องกับโมเดล WAP:
1. Application Layer
WML เป็นภาษาการเขียนโปรแกรมที่ใช้สำหรับการพัฒนาเนื้อหาและมี Wireless Application Environment (WAE) และข้อกำหนดอุปกรณ์มือถือ
2. เซสชันเลเยอร์
Wireless Session Protocol (WSP) แสดงถึงชั้นเซสชัน เซสชันไร้สายถูกระงับและเชื่อมต่อใหม่อย่างรวดเร็วโดยใช้ WSP
3. ชั้นธุรกรรม
WTP (Wireless Transaction Protocol) และ user datagram protocol (UDP) ประกอบขึ้นเป็นชั้นธุรกรรม การสนับสนุนธุรกรรมมีให้โดยชั้นนี้ของ TCP/IP
4. เลเยอร์ความปลอดภัย
ในระหว่างการส่งข้อมูล จะให้ความสมบูรณ์ของข้อมูล ความเป็นส่วนตัว และการรับรองความถูกต้องผ่าน Wireless Transaction Layer Security (WTLS)
5. ชั้นขนส่ง
Wireless Datagram Protocol (WDP) เป็นส่วนหนึ่งของเลเยอร์นี้ สแตกโปรโตคอล WAP ได้ประโยชน์จากรูปแบบข้อมูลที่สอดคล้องกัน
WAP เป็นหลักสำหรับเนื้อหาเว็บ
โดยพื้นฐานแล้ว WAP เป็นแอปพลิเคชั่นสำหรับส่งเนื้อหาเว็บผ่านเครือข่ายไร้สาย ซึ่งมีความเร็วต่ำและเวลาในการตอบสนองที่แปรผัน ในปัจจุบัน ข้อจำกัดด้านหน่วยความจำของอุปกรณ์ไร้สายแบบใช้มือถือทำให้การแคชไม่มีประสิทธิภาพมากในการลดปริมาณข้อมูลที่ดาวน์โหลด
อนาคตของ WAP
ภายใน WAP Forum บริการมือถือมัลติมีเดียเป็นพื้นที่ที่น่าสนใจในปัจจุบัน โปรโตคอลแบบเปิด WAP v1.1 และ v1.2 ช่วยให้สามารถขนส่งเนื้อหามัลติมีเดียได้หลายประเภท อย่างไรก็ตาม ยังคงมีความจำเป็นในการปรับปรุง WAP เพิ่มเติมสำหรับบริการมัลติมีเดียบางอย่าง โดยเฉพาะอย่างยิ่งบริการที่ใช้สื่อสตรีมมิ่ง
ขณะที่อ่านข้อความนี้ การประมูลรอบถัดไปสำหรับใบอนุญาตโทรศัพท์มือถือกำลังอยู่ในระหว่างดำเนินการ เมื่อมีการสร้างเครือข่ายโทรศัพท์มือถือใหม่ บทบาทของ WAP ก็จะเพิ่มขึ้น เนื่องจากจะมีแบนด์วิดท์ที่พร้อมใช้งานมากขึ้นและความสามารถในการรองรับอัตราการถ่ายโอนข้อมูลที่สูง
สามารถใช้ WAP กับเครือข่ายมือถือใหม่ได้แล้ว แต่คาดว่าจะเห็นความสามารถของ WAP เพิ่มขึ้นเพื่อรองรับกราฟิกสี การสตรีมวิดีโอและเสียงแบบสดและที่บันทึกไว้ โดยเฉพาะอย่างยิ่ง บริการโทรทัศน์ที่ส่งโดยตรงไปยังโทรศัพท์มือถือ
ความคิดสุดท้าย
WAP เป็นรูปแบบการเขียนโปรแกรมหรือสภาพแวดล้อมของแอปพลิเคชันและชุดของโปรโตคอลการสื่อสารตามแนวคิดของเวิลด์ไวด์เว็บ การออกแบบลำดับชั้นของ WAP นั้นคล้ายกับของสแต็คโปรโตคอล TCP/IP อย่างน่าทึ่ง
อย่างไรก็ตาม WAP ไม่ได้ถูกนำมาใช้กันอย่างแพร่หลายในหลายประเทศ และการใช้งานก็ลดลงอย่างมากในช่วงปี 2010 เนื่องจากความเข้ากันได้ของ HTML แพร่กระจายไปทั่วโทรศัพท์มือถือ
แหล่งข้อมูลที่เป็นประโยชน์อื่นๆ:
ผลกระทบของแพลตฟอร์ม M-Commerce ต่อธุรกิจในอนาคต
ธนาคารบนมือถือ | ทุกสิ่งที่คุณต้องรู้
บล็อกข้อความเซิร์ฟเวอร์คืออะไรและทำงานอย่างไร
5 เทคโนโลยีที่ซิสโก้คิดว่าจะพลิกโฉม